Let’s dive into the checklist of items and tools you’ll need to embark on this epic journey of crafting your own compressed air dryer:

  1. Tubing Galore: Go big or go home! Opt for 1-inch tubing for maximum surface area and moisture separation efficiency. Richard swears by it, and who are we to argue?
  2. Valve Extravaganza: Secure those shutoff valves for controlled bursts of air release. Consider those little knobs—easy control is the name of the game.
  3. Water Separators: Follow Richard’s footsteps and invest in quality water separators and fine mist separators. SMC seems to be the go-to for moisture-free air.
  4. T-fittings and Reducers: Strategically position your T-fittings to induce turbulence and create a drop zone for moisture. And don’t forget those reducers for seamless transitions.
  5. Soldering Arsenal: Equip yourself with soldering skills and gear. Richard insists on soldering for robust joints, ensuring no leaks or mishaps.
  6. A Compressor to Rule Them All: Richard sings praises for his Porter Cable model, and why not? It’s a 60-gallon powerhouse, delivering 150 psi of compressed air goodness.
  7. Space Considerations: If your shop allows, create a gap behind the setup for increased airflow. Richard’s tip: four inches for that perfect sweet spot.
  8. Electric Valve & Timer (Optional): For the tech enthusiasts, an electric valve with a timer could automate the draining process. Convenience at its finest.
  9. Copper, Not PVC: Don’t even think about PVC. Richard’s thermal coefficient lesson emphasizes copper’s superiority. PVC is a waste of your hard-earned money.
  10. Galvanized vs. Copper Fittings: Richard’s galvanized fittings haven’t betrayed him yet, but some caution against potential corrosion. Copper or plastic alternatives might be worth exploring.

Other technical specifications:

  • PVC = 0.17 W/m K
  • Steel = 43 W/m K
  • Copper = 413 W/m K

  2. Tube Size Matters:
    • Emphasizes using one-inch tubing for better performance.
    • Larger tubing allows for slower air velocity, reducing the risk of moisture being pulled along.
  3. Moisture Removal Demonstration:
    • Demonstrates draining moisture from the system by cracking open valves at different points.
    • Highlights the effectiveness of the setup in removing moisture even at high pressure.
  4. Additional Filtration for CNC Plasma Table:
    • Introduces water separator and fine mist separator for CNC plasma table use.
    • Explains the importance of clean and dry air for optimal CNC plasma table performance.
